| Obverse lettering | 泰 寶 通 德 (Translation: Thái Đức Thông Bảo Thái Đức (Emperor) / Universal currency) |
| Reverse description | Plain flat field surrounding the central square hole, with a single crescent mark positioned to the left of the hole. The crescent serves as a mint or workshop differentiating mark. The reverse rim mirrors the obverse with a simple raised border. The surface shows the characteristic texture of cast copper coinage. Varieties exist with the crescent placed below, to the left, or with four crescents surrounding the hole. |
